<p>Jhansi: A day after a woman student of a government paramedical college here was allegedly harassed and assaulted, her fellow students staged a protest outside the campus gate on Sunday demanding action against the perpetrators of the incident.</p>.<p>The demonstration was called off after the college's director assured the protesters that their demands would be addressed, officials said.</p>.<p>Additional Superintendent of Police (City) Gyanendra Kumar Singh said a student of BSc Radiology was heading from the girls' hostel to the administrative building on Saturday afternoon to seek permission to visit her home in Farrukhabad.</p>.<p>On the way, two unidentified persons attacked her in a secluded area behind the hostel, sprayed a powder in her eyes and attempted to assault her, the officer said. In the scuffle, parts of her clothes were also torn and she briefly lost consciousness, he said.</p>.Elderly man dies, two injured in bee attack in UP's Ballia.<p>She was rushed to a medical facility by fellow students, and then the college administration was informed.</p>.<p>However, when no action was taken, the police were alerted in the night, Singh said, adding a case has been registered based on the student's complaint and an investigation initiated.</p>.<p>On Sunday, dozens of students gathered at the college gate, demanding the immediate arrest of the culprits and improved security on campus.</p>.<p>The college's director Dr Anshul Jain said the administration has requested a police inquiry and has written to authorities about the students' other demands. Security around the hostel has also been increased, he added.</p>.<p>The victim's classmates claimed that miscreants had previously attempted to snatch her laptop outside the hostel. They also mentioned that she has a medical condition that causes frequent spells of unconsciousness and is already undergoing treatment for it. </p>
